Steve Harvey Joins Good Morning America

By Chris Ariens 

Author, actor and comedian, Steve Harvey is joining “Good Morning Amerca” as a special correspondent. Harvey, who also hosts a daily radio show, will report on topics ranging from relationships to parenting over the next few months. In a press release, ABC announced Harvey, “will bring his own unique perspective, style and humor to morning television while interacting with viewers around the country via ABCNEWS.com, Skype and live guests in-studio.”

His first report airs Wednesday.

AUTHOR, COMEDIAN, ACTOR AND RADIO HOST, STEVE HARVEY, TO JOIN GOOD MORNING AMERICA

Harvey’s First Report on GMA Airs Wednesday, August 19

Steve Harvey, author, comedian, actor and host of “The Steve Harvey Morning Show”, has joined ABC’s “Good Morning America,” it was announced today by senior executive producer Jim Murphy. Harvey will bring “GMA” viewers a series of reports on topics ranging from relationships to parenting over the next few months. He will bring his own unique perspective, style and humor to morning television while interacting with viewers around the country via ABCNEWS.com, Skype and live guests in-studio. His first report is scheduled to air Wednesday, August 19.

Steve Harvey is an author, comedian, actor and radio host who has appeared in television and movies, including seven years starring on the WB’s “The Steve Harvey Show.” Harvey has also appeared in numerous movies, including “Don’t Trip…; “Johnson Family Vacation” and the animated film “Racing Stripes.” Harvey’s book “Act Like A Lady, Think Like a Man” was an instant hit with women across the country and landed the #1 spot on the New York Times Bestseller List for an impressive 26 weeks. Harvey’s radio show, “The Steve Harvey Morning Show,” is syndicated by Premiere Radio and heard in 60 markets around the country. Steve Harvey is also involved in helping young people and founded: The Steve Harvey Foundation. Harvey is a native of Cleveland, Ohio and currently resides in New York City.

ABC News’ “Good Morning America” is co-anchored by Diane Sawyer and Robin Roberts. Chris Cuomo is the news anchor and Sam Champion is the weather anchor. The Emmy-award winning morning program airs live Monday through Friday from 7:00am to 9:00am/EDT on the ABC Television Network. Jim Murphy is the senior executive producer and Tom Cibrowski is the executive producer of ABC News’ “Good Morning America.”
